Opening remarks on the UAE’s AI vision
Khaldoon Khalifa Al Mubarak, Chairman of the Executive Affairs Authority, delivered the opening remarks, highlighting the leadership’s vision for AI and innovation. He also presented real-life examples demonstrating how AI is shaping daily routines and improving quality of life.
Participation of ministers and key officials
The session featured contributions from Sarah Al Amiri, Omar Sultan Al Olama, Mansoor Al Mansoori, Dr Mohamed Al Askar, Dr Mohamed Al Kuwaiti, Ahmed Yahia Al Idrissi, Peng Xiao, and other senior officials, reflecting the national importance of AI in all sectors.

UAE’s proactive AI initiatives
The session showcased major national initiatives, including the AI Readiness Index and the Large Language Model Alignment Index, both aimed at strengthening infrastructure, talent development, competitiveness, and cultural alignment in AI applications.
Live demonstration of TAMM services
A live demonstration showed how the TAMM app integrates services from various government entities—such as vehicle renewal, insurance, and payments—and provides instant AI-powered support.

Senior leadership attendance
Held at Qasr Al Bahr, the event was attended, along with His Highness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, by His Highness Sheikh Khaled bin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an and several other sheikhs, ministers, and senior officials, underscoring the national priority placed on advancing AI.
